Restaurants around Williams

KFC

800 N. Grand Canyon Boulevard
Williams, AZ 86046

Taco Bell

800 N. Grand Canyon Boulevard
Williams, AZ 86046

Pizza Hut

888 N Grand Canyon Blvd
Williams, AZ 86046
Type in your Search Keyword(s) and Press Enter...